Valve Stems
Monty in shop for warranty repairs and replacing "rubber" tire valve stems with high pressure steel ones. Dealer states they are having problems finding steel stems to fit the rims on the Monty. 2011 3400RL and the tires are G614's. Anyone have specific info on what to get and how to get. Gave them printout of stems mentioned by someone on MOC but they didn't work according to dealer. Dealer is charging $17 per tire plus cost of valve stems so shouldn't matter to them. Thanks,

I use TR-416 Clamp-on that I got from Carquest. The rubber snap-in is only good to 60psi.

I just had a second flat on truck this year. First one in Texas (pulling Monty) was a cracked rubber valve stem. This latest one also looks like the valve stem (not pulling Monty). I am not returning to the tire shop that sold and installed the truck tires because they broke a lug nut off and didn't tell me. Now, it looks as if they used cheap rubber snap in valve stems. First priority has been the Monty and then the truck before our next trip. NAPA has a 416 all metal and going with that on the truck. Tredit, the wheel maker on the Montana, recommended 416S for the Monty. I am learning a lot but the tuition is expensive!
